Transaction afbd893ef1124e6d804e1b1e2fbe4bf3163e396fffa62e5da0676e6729b24fcf
1 Input
2 Outputs
- afbd893ef1124e6d804e1b1e2fbe4bf3163e396fffa62e5da0676e6729b24fcf:0
- afbd893ef1124e6d804e1b1e2fbe4bf3163e396fffa62e5da0676e6729b24fcf:1
value 28488475
address 1BDE7HFZ5VV25TdJiL6HFUX1dMY7XXVBFn
value 1782985194
address 1PiCb9KpfwcNSxvduTmKpxVR6KVbBYu5wp